A test has 10 questions. You must answer a total of 7 questions, including exactly 4 of the first 6 questions. A) In how many ways can you choose 4 of the first 6 questions? B) How many questions are left after you have answered 4 of the first 6 questions? How many must you still answer? C) In how many ways can you choose questions to finish the test? D) How many different ways are there of completing the test (meeting all of its requirements)? *** note.. I have answered question A
A you are being asked for "6 choose 4" written as \[\binom{6}{4}\] or \[_6C_4\] pr even \[^6C_4\] and computed via \[\binom{6}{4}=\frac{6\times 5}{2}\] cancel first multiply last
